The Miami Dolphins' 2008 offseason will go down as an eventful one, to say the least. First came the firing of virtually everyone who had anything to do with prior years' teams, followed by team owner Wayne Huizenga hiring Bill Parcells to bring some law and order to the franchise. It'd probably be better for both Taylor and the Phins for them to trade him. There's definitely going to be contenders out there willing to trade for a premier pass rusher. I don't know how effective Taylor will be in 2 or 3 years. It's going to take that long for the Dolphins to build a team that's going to be a serious contender. While the media certainly hasn't helped his trade value, they should still be able to get something decent back in return for him. I mean, he's only two years removed from the Defensive Player of the Year honor. If they could get some decent picks for the future for Taylor, they shouldn't be hesitant to pull the trigger. He wants to play for a winner and Miami just isn't there yet.
